High resolution performance results 
DoubleMachReflectionStudy
  24 processors 
-  Clawpack: base level 170x140 cells with 3-4 more levels, (x,y)[(-.005,.08)(.0,.07)], max cfl 0.9
-  WENO-TCD: base level 340x320 cells with 4 more levels refined 2,2,2,2 times respectively, (x,y)[(-.005,.08)(.0,.08)], max cfl 0.85)
